About Sharing Burdens

The Bible offers guidance on sharing personal struggles and situations, emphasizing wisdom, discretion, and trust. Here are some key principles:

 

1. Seek Wise and Trusted Individuals

The Bible encourages sharing with trustworthy, mature believers who can offer support, encouragement, and wise counsel.

 

Proverbs 11:14* — *”Where there is no guidance, a people falls, but in an abundance of counselors there is safety.”

James 5:16* — *”Therefore, confess your sins to one another and pray for one another, that you may be healed.”

 

This suggests that sharing with trusted, mature believers is beneficial, especially in times of difficulty.

 

2. Be Discerning About Who to Share With

While sharing is encouraged, the Bible also warns about being cautious with whom you share sensitive information.

 

Proverbs 13:3* — *”Whoever guards his mouth preserves his life; he who opens wide his lips comes to ruin.”

Proverbs 27:6* — *”Faithful are the wounds of a friend; profuse are the kisses of an enemy.”

 

This highlights the importance of choosing trustworthy individuals and being cautious about sharing with just anyone.

 

3. God Desides Who to Share With

Ultimately, the Bible suggests that prayerful discernment should guide whom you confide in.

 

Proverbs 3:5-6* — *”Trust in the Lord with all your heart, and do not lean on your own understanding. In all your ways acknowledge him, and he will make straight your paths.”

 

Seeking God’s guidance before sharing personal struggles is wise.

 

4. Sharing for Support and Healing

Sharing your situation can bring relief, prayer support, and wisdom, especially when done with discernment.

 

Galatians 6:2* — *”Bear one another’s burdens, and so fulfill the law of Christ.”

 

Summary:

The Bible encourages sharing your struggles with trusted, mature believers who can provide support and wise counsel, but it also advises caution and discernment in choosing whom to confide in. Prayerfully seek God’s guidance before sharing sensitive details, and aim to share with those who will handle your situation with care and confidentiality.
